Does anyone make their own feed? Recipes? Suggestions?
I have a couple chickens coming this weekend, my daughters friend is moving and giving me his chickens, coop etc. I have wanted chickens for a while now. I would like to feed them the best diet possible and have been reading up. What do y’all feed yours?
 
The best diet possible is the feed manufactured and sold in stores. Unlike humans, they aren’t marketing addictive junk food. They are marketing food that
Results in the absolute healthiest chicken possible. No health = bad results for sales of meat and eggs which means no food sales.
 
Mine eat Purina's Flock Raiser, a good complete feed that's always fresh (by mill date) at the feed stores here.
Ask what they have been eating, and buy a decent FRESH bag of an all flock feed at your feed store, and then some extra goodies are okay too.
Home made is difficult, and expensive, and not worth the time and effort, unless you are talking about hundreds of birds, and years of experience.
